ایونت ترکینگ Event Tracking
در این ویدئو میخواهیم در مورد مفهوم Event و پروسه Event Tracking صحبت کنیم.
یک سری Interactionها در صفحات رخ میدهند که به صورت عادی توسط آنالیتیکس ردگیری نمیشوند و ما باید از طریق ایونتها، آنها را به سمت آنالیتیکس ارسال کنیم.
فرض کنید یک مطلب چهار هزار کلمهای در بلاگ دارید، پاسخ به این پرسش که آیا کاربران این مطلب را به طور کامل مطالعه میکنند یا خیر، میتواند نقش مهمی در استراتژی محتوای سایت شما داشته باشد. دیتای اسکرول صفحه میتواند دراینباره به شما کمک کند که آیا کاربران تا انتهای صفحه را پیمایش کردهاند یا خیر. آیا این پیمایش به معنای مفید شناخته شدن و خواندن کامل محتوا بوده یا صرفاً محتوا اسکن شده است.
یا در مورد ویدئوهای آموزشی و تیزرهای تبلیغاتی، اینکه کاربر ویدئو را به طور کامل تماشا میکند یا فقط بخشی از آن را، در کدام ثانیه از تماشای ادامه ویدئو صرف نظر میکند. یا کاربری که یک فرم خاص در صفحهای از سایت را تکمیل کرده است از کجا و کدام Source وارد این صفحه شده است.
اینها دادههایی هستند که به صورت پیش فرض توسط آنالیتیکس جمعآوری نمیشوند. بهطور کلی Interactionهایی که در صفحه رخ میدهند را بهعنوان ایونت میشناسیم و با پروسه Event Tracking ایونتها را به سمت آنالیتیکس ارسال میکنیم. یکی از ابزارهای کاربردی جهت انجام این کار تگ منیجر است.
روش و مسیر انجام Event Tracking
جهت انجام این کار بدین صورت پیش بروید:
تگ جدید را از نوع Google Analytics Universal تعریف کنید و Track Type آن را روی Event بگذارید. با انتخاب این نوع، چهار پارامتر برای پروسه Event Tracking قابل تنظیم خواهد بود که به شرح زیر هستند:
پارامتر Category: مشخص کردن دستهبندی اولیه. فرض کنید بخواهید کل Call To Actionهای یک صفحه را ردگیری (Track) کنید. پارامتر Category همۀ اینها را CTA تعریف میکنیم.
پارامتر Action: مشخص کردن دستهبندیهای ثانویه. مثلا Home Page CTA
پارامتر Label: در اینجا معمولاً از متغیرها استفاده میکنیم تا یک مقدار داینامیک را انتقال دهیم.
اگر به بخش Variables بروید، تعدادی متغیر از پیش تعریف شده (Built-in Variables) میبینید که هر کدام کارکرد خاصی دارند. چند متغیر Built-in مهم از این قرارند:
Page URL: آدرس کامل صفحهای که هم اکنون کاربر حضور دارد را نگه میدارد.
Page Path: آدرس صفحه از بعد از دامین اصلی را نگه میدارد.
Click Classes: کلاس اِلمانی که روی آن کلیک شده است را نگه میدارد.
Click Text: محتوای دکمه یا لینک کلیک شده را نگه میدارد.
Click ID: شناسه اِلمانی که روی آن کلیک شده است، را نگه میدارد.
Click URL: آدرس صفحهای که کاربر پس از کلیک روی اِلمان، به آن منتقل شود را نگه میدارد.
Form ID: شناسه فرم را ذخیره میکند.
برای ردگیری CTA که در بالا گفته شد، در پارامتر Label، باید مطلبی که کلیک میشود را ردگیری کنیم و متغیر Page Path را انتخاب میکنیم، ID اکانت آنالیتیکس را وارد کرده و تگ را ذخیره میکنیم.
بهتر است از قبل به تمام اکشنهایی که قصد Track آنها را دارید، فکر کنید و لیستی از آنها آماده کنید. پس از اتمام کار هم، لیستی کامل از کلیه ایونتهایی که Track میکنید به همراه پارامترهای Event Tracking، تگها و تریگرهای مربوطه داکیومنت کنید تا در گزارشگیری به شما کمک کند.
خلاصه موضوعات ویدئو
مفهوم Event و Event Tracking
یکسری از اطلاعات در حالت عادی توسط گوگل آنالیتیکس(Google Analytics) جمع آوری نمی شوند و بایستی ما آن ها را به سمت آنالیتیکس ارسال کنیم. این کار به کمک تعریف Event در تگ منیجر(Tag Manager) انجام می شود و به آن Event Tracking گفته می شود.
چگونه در تگ منیجر یک Event تعریف کنیم؟
ما می توانیم به راحتی و به کمک تگ منیجر(Tag Manager)، Event های مد نظرمان را بسازیم. در این ویدئو 0 تا 100 ساخت ایونت(Event) در تگ منیجر آموزش داده شده است.